Specs That Actually Matter

Most sourcing mistakes start with a buyer approving a photo, not a spec sheet. For a polycarbonate water bottle custom order, we want a working drawing with capacity, neck finish, lid type, wall thickness, base shape, and logo placement called out on it. If those items are missing, the factory fills the blanks with its own guess. Then the bottle lands, and the buyer says it “looks fine” but holds wrong in the hand. We see that on the line all the time.

For a 500 ml to 1 L bottle, 1.8-2.5 mm wall thickness is a sensible starting point. Go thinner and the math starts to wobble: lower material cost, yes, but more warp risk and a hollow feel that buyers flag fast. The lid is not a throwaway part. Thread pitch, gasket material, and torque need to match, or the cap starts leaking after a few opening cycles. For a custom growler format, the same rule applies, but the neck and handle zone need tighter control because the bottle carries more load and gets handled differently. We run torque checks with a simple cap tester, and that catches a lot before QC pulls the sample.

A customized growler or customized canteen should also include a defined carton insert. In shipping, the damage often comes from the bottle moving inside the master carton, not from the bottle body itself. We’ve seen that go sideways on a 24-bottle shipper when the insert was 2 mm too loose. Better spec sheets cut down the back-and-forth before production starts, and they save everyone from a typo on the PO turning into a week of rework.

Decoration has to follow the bottle, not the other way around. We run pad printing and silk screen on polycarbonate all the time, and laser marking only works on some cap parts; the ink system and cure temperature have to match the substrate. For a canteen promotional order with a clean logo and a tight lead time, one-color silk screen is usually the safest call. If the artwork carries three colors or tiny type, QC pulled the sample first and checked registration before anyone signed off on the proof.

The rule is simple: keep the logo off the hard-wear zones. Curved bodies, grip bands, and the base edge take abuse first, and that is where print starts to crack or rub off. On a distributor growler or distributor drinkware package, buyers often push for a full-wrap graphic. It can be done, but only if we control distortion on the curved panel and hold the same placement from the first piece to the 5,000th. Compliance and Testing

Compliance is where a serious canteen supplier separates itself from a trading listing. For export into Europe, you need food-contact declarations and REACH-related documentation where it applies. For North America, the buyer usually asks for FDA-related materials statements, plus safety paperwork tied to the actual use. If the product is sold as a reusable container, the label claims must match the resin and the test results. We have seen a buyer flag a PO because the carton said PET instead of PC. Clean-looking bottles still fail.

Good practice is to request pre-production samples and test them against the exact use case. A real canteen factory in China should support incoming material checks, in-process inspection, and final AQL sampling before shipment. On one run, QC pulled the sample at the capper, checked 0.6 N·m closing torque, and held the lot when the seal line looked off. A common export plan is AQL 2.5 for major defects and 4.0 for minor defects, but you can tighten that if the order is high value or retail-critical. For custom drinkware, the cartons, inner bags, and master case marks are part of compliance too, because the wrong label can stall customs or trigger a retailer chargeback.

MOQ, Cost, and Lead Time

Price only makes sense when you break the order into parts. A polycarbonate water bottle custom job usually splits into mold amortization, bottle body, lid, decoration, packaging, and freight. On the line, a 500 ml bottle can look cheap until you add 2-color pad print, 5-ply master cartons, and export test reports. We had a buyer flag a PO because the carton insert was left out of the math by 0.08 USD/pc. Ask for the full cost stack, not a single piece price.

For most programs, the real MOQ is 3,000 pcs per SKU, with cleaner pricing at 5,000 or 10,000 pcs. Complex lids, special colors, or new tooling can push that higher. Standard lead time after sample approval is 25-35 days if resin and packaging parts are in stock. New tooling adds another 15-25 days, and if the buyer changes the cap height after T1, the schedule slips fast. We run into this all the time. A QC pull once found a 1.2 mm gate mark on the first shot, and that is the kind of detail that moves dates. For a canteen customized for retail or a custom canteen for a distributor program, add 3-5% spare parts if the lid assembly is finicky.

Frequently asked questions

Is polycarbonate safe for reusable water bottles?

For a reusable bottle, polycarbonate can be acceptable if the resin grade, processing, and use case are defined correctly. You should request food-contact paperwork, REACH-related documentation for Europe, and material traceability by lot. The practical issue is not only safety, but wear: after 200-300 wash cycles, a low-grade surface can haze or scratch more easily than premium alternatives. For cold-water retail, gym, or event use, it is common. For hot-fill or harsh dishwasher conditions, it is less forgiving. A serious canteen manufacturer in China should explain those limits before you place the order.

What MOQ should I expect for a custom canteen order?

For most polycarbonate bottle programs, a standard MOQ is 3,000 pcs per SKU. If you want special lid tooling, non-standard color matching, or a highly customized canteen shape, the MOQ can move to 5,000 pcs or more. The real number depends on how many cavities the mold has and whether the supplier is combining your order with existing components. For repeat distributor drinkware programs, 10,000 pcs often gets better unit pricing. Always ask whether the MOQ applies per color, per size, or per print version, because that changes your buying plan.

How long does production usually take in China?

For a standard polycarbonate water bottle custom order, production is usually 25-35 days after sample approval and deposit confirmation. If the project needs new tooling, allow an extra 15-25 days before mass production starts. If packaging is custom printed, add time for carton proofing and pre-production approval. A canteen factory in Zhejiang with stable resin supply can often move faster on repeat orders, especially when the lid and bottle body are already approved. Shipping time is separate, so buyers in Europe and North America should also build in ocean transit and customs clearance.

Can I use one mold for a customized growler and a standard bottle?

Usually no, not without compromising fit or appearance. A customized growler has different wall mass, handle geometry, and often a wider opening than a standard water bottle. Even if the capacity is similar, the neck finish and cap system usually change the tooling requirement. You can sometimes share a component, such as a lid family, across multiple SKUs, but the bottle body itself generally needs its own mold. If you want a distributor growler line and a separate custom drinkware bottle line, ask the supplier to quote shared parts and dedicated parts separately.

What quality checks should I require before shipment?

Ask for a final inspection based on AQL 2.5 major and 4.0 minor defects, unless your retail customer requires tighter terms. The inspection should cover sealing, logo alignment, cap torque, surface clarity, carton marks, and leak testing. If the product is a canteen promotional item, confirm that the print matches the approved Pantone reference within the agreed tolerance. For larger programs, ask for photo records from the packing line and one retained sample per SKU. A good canteen supplier will also show you how they separate approved stock from quarantined stock before loading.
